There's a big difference between routines and rules. Rules tend to focus on expected individual student
behaviors, like being on time for class, respecting others, or not talking on the phone during instruction.
Routines are simply practiced responses to the teacher's directions that add structure to the day. "Rules
have consequences, and routines have reminders," says Rebecca Alber, a UCLA literacy specialist.

Importance of establishing classroom routines.
Students understand what is expected of them and how to complete particular tasks on their own when
routines and processes are carefully taught, modeled, and established in the classroom. These reliable
patterns enable teachers to devote more time to purposeful teaching. Additionally, It establishes a
feeling of responsibility to the students and enables the learner to form a habit each time he or she
comes to school and it helps the teacher maintain effective classroom management.
